Impact of Fragrance Changes on the Asian and Pacific Region
Asia-Pacific is a highly dynamic and complex series of individual markets which often have little in common except their geographical location. As economic wealth leads to experimentation, we are likely to see growing numbers of Western products appearing in the... markets of Beijing, Shanghai and Guangzhou. Many of these products will set the standard for locally manufactured products to follow.

U.S. Market of Flavors & Fragrances
The U.S. flavor and fragrance industry occupies a very important place on the world scene (probably between 25% and 30% world market share). There is much confusion, misinterpretation and misunderstanding concerning its real market size and trends, which is due to an inadequate definition of terms and also to bad research and research methods.

Digitally Released Aroma and the Flavorist
In this technology, an aroma, dispersed in a specially selected solvent system, is adsorbed on a chemically inert carrier material, again selected for its compatibility within the total system, and released in a stream of carrier gas at an electronically controlled moment for a brief and precisely controllable time span through an outlet ergonomically designed to lead it to the consumer’s nose with minimal spill-over to the environment.
